Output ef9c8a80cfac9a03227d860374bd2e1a90dde4c3e6dce4007134e27db8749355:0

value
103780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d132b85872ce9656ecd14089c5cf74ad7779be32 OP_EQUALVERIFY OP_CHECKSIG
address
1L58zBqbjzqhWSrLPr4c2AnoQMdevbqHW3
transaction
ef9c8a80cfac9a03227d860374bd2e1a90dde4c3e6dce4007134e27db8749355
confirmations
521420
spent
true